Bill Summary
An Act ENROLLED SENATE BILL NO. 358 By: Daniels of the Senate and Echols, Conley, Hill, and Hays of the House An Act relating to the Lindsey Nicole Henry Scholarships for Students with Disabilities Program; amending 70 O.S. 2021, Section 13-101.2, which relates to eligibility for the program; providing eligibility for certain students experiencing homelessness; modifying reference to weights to be used in certain calculation; providing for calculation of scholarship amount if certain private school does not charge tuition; and updating statutory language. AI Summary
This bill amends the Lindsey Nicole Henry Scholarships for Students with Disabilities Program to remove the requirement that a student must have attended a public school in the prior school year to be eligible for the scholarship. The bill also allows students experiencing homelessness and students who were in out-of-home placement or adopted from the Department of Human Services to be eligible for the scholarship without the prior school year attendance requirement. Additionally, the bill provides clarification on how the scholarship amount is calculated, including if a private school does not charge tuition.
